Output aebf6118ca683c425f32f7c693d6705614ba9d5422a2b8d9dc7765be9eb3916d:4

value
93211427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42f78e037e2af4be1629058e2ac28a1fb9747f89 OP_EQUAL
address
37o75cJbXQ2jmBxjKvTbLuk7KQDUKv1Vfz
transaction
aebf6118ca683c425f32f7c693d6705614ba9d5422a2b8d9dc7765be9eb3916d
spent
true